Solid defending thwarts Cambridge University and Havering forwards very unlucky not to convert their opportunities.

Havering earned their first point of the season with a hard-fought draw away at Cambridge University.

On a hot, energy sapping day, Havering had to be organised and resilient against a side they lost to 4-0 last season. The visitors started well, with Harry Jenkins and Jack Barlow controlling possession from defence and Paul Johnson and Stuart Garnell both having shots saved inside the first ten minutes.

As the first half progressed, the students imposed their fast play and movement on the match. Havering were pushed deeper into their own half but compact defending restricted Cambridge opportunities to a series of short corners, which were denied by reflex saves by Havering goalkeeper Lee Bennett. A further Bennett save from a reverse-stick shot on the stroke of half-time kept Havering level on terms at the break.

Havering pressed higher up the pitch in the second half and caused a greater threat. Tireless running and intelligent movement from forwards Alex Lee and Liam Appleyard stretched the University defence and created openings for the midfielders to exploit. Lee was unlucky to deflect Alastair Lewis' cross wide and came even closer minutes late when he deflected a Paul Dover shot onto the post.

Havering had nothing to show for their pressure and, as the game entered the final fifteen minutes, the match entered a stalemate as the two sides cancelled each. In midfield, Alex Defroand earned Man of the Match on his return to the team after two years away studying in the US. A draw and a clean sheet gives Havering plenty of positives to build on as their season continues at home to Wapping 2s this coming Saturday.
